Three Dogs and Two Cats Need Loving Homes

Three dogs and two cats are being featured by Animal Friends for Education and Welfare this week for adoption.

The Animal Friends for Education and Welfare has some new pets up for adoption this week! 

Here is the information about the animals, provided by AFEW:

Summer

Well, here I am...after about 5 years and multiple litters my previous owners left me to fend for myself. My foster mom has taken me in with her three other little canine family members. I am about 10 lbs. and will be spayed shortly. I am a work in progress as I learn to share my foster mom with others. I am potty trained and always stay close in the yard! At some point a human stepped on my front right paw so I walk with a bit of a limp...but don't worry, I have learned to get by just fine. I prefer a quiet home and a warm comfy lap to snuggle into! 


Windsor

Windsor is a very intelligent boy. He is very good on a leash. He is active and needs daily exercise. Windsor is happiest curled up in a little ball next to his owner or on the couch. He gets along with other dogs but maybe best as the only dog or with people who have experience with multiple dogs. Windsor is crate trained and likes his fluffy bed in his crate. There is no doubt that Windsor will make a great addition to any family who has love to share with this very beautiful boy.

Motorboat & Rocky

Motorboat is a tuxedo with a white tipped tail. He is friendly and outgoing and has a delicate build. He does all the talking, but will take a backseat to his brother.

Rocky is the strong silent type who loves to play laser tag - the kitty kind. He's afraid of thunder so he'll hide under the closest coat or covers during a storm!

These beautiful, bi-color brothers are indoor cats, neutered, 10 yrs old and in excellent health.  They are trained to use the bathroom toilet, but can be reintroduced to a litter box.

Maya

Maya was surrendered by her owner along with two of her pups from a previous litter and her mate. She is now residing in an AFEW foster home. Maya was very pregnant when she came into the shelter on May 19. AFEW placed her in a foster home on May 17.  Maya delivered 12 beautiful pups on Monday, May 27th, Memorial Day. Mom and babies are doing well. Puppies have all been adopted.  Now mom needs a new home!


There are many animals up for adoption at Animal Friends for Education and Welfare. The descriptions above, provided by AFEW, are of the featured pets of the week.
